Experts at EATS 2025 discuss innovative strategies for tackling workforce challenges, enhancing digital adoption, and shifting from mere cost-cutting to sustainable value creation.
In a rapidly evolving landscape, food manufacturing leaders are redefining their approaches to operations, workforce, and technology. The insights gathered from industry executives and innovators at this year’s EATS show highlight a critical shift: the industry is progressing beyond traditional efficiency metrics to more integrated, data-centric strategies that harmonize human talent with technological advancements.

The Importance of Real-Time Visibility
Today’s manufacturers recognize that the first step in digital transformation involves achieving real-time visibility on the plant floor.
“Without connection and measurement, improvement remains impossible.” — Catherine Tardif, Director of Account Management, Worximity
Manufacturers can no longer afford to remain in the dark. Better data can lead to significant cost savings, such as addressing hidden downtime losses. However, connecting disparate data across various systems poses a challenge.
“Data exists in various formats and must be aggregated to extract actionable insights.” — Ernesto Hermosillo, Chief Growth Officer, Allie
Compliance as a Competitive Advantage
Real-time visibility is reshaping how manufacturers approach food safety and compliance.
“Compliance is shifting from a checkbox exercise to a strategic priority.” — Mike Clark, Global Strategic Account Manager, SafetyChain Software
Manufacturers who leverage digitization for compliance are gaining a competitive edge, as immediate access to reliable data becomes crucial in the market. This transformation not only improves compliance but also enhances overall business performance.
Addressing Workforce Challenges
The human element of manufacturing faces the greatest challenges today.
“Almost half of the manufacturing workforce is nearing retirement age.” — Mike Burica, Chief Commercial Officer, WorkForge
To address turnover and nurture a trustful working environment, manufacturers should focus on safety, competency, and growth opportunities.
- Safety: “Ensure workers feel secure.”
- Competency: “Help them perform their jobs effectively.”
- Growth: “Provide opportunities for career advancement.”
Transforming Waste into Resources
Manufacturers are re-evaluating what was previously deemed as unavoidable waste.
“Waste can be utilized; it’s not inherently a loss.” — Gary Schuler, Founder & President, GTF Technologies
Today’s manufacturers are leveraging technology to convert byproducts into profitable materials, illustrating that viewing waste through a fresh lens can unlock new revenue streams.
